Output d66e55daa85a480edb72cb3253d602433369f22dad0e4606afb824cad0bd31e8:19

value
20918
script pubkey
OP_0 OP_PUSHBYTES_32 40c65e18e70e6826c05d997582263b7266286fdf4cd26591b290f160d121ca90
address
bc1qgrr9ux88pe5zdszan96cyf3mwfnzsm7lfnfxtydjjrckp5fpe2gqhyauuf
transaction
d66e55daa85a480edb72cb3253d602433369f22dad0e4606afb824cad0bd31e8